Yeah, I had a cherry bomb glass pack installed where the resoniator used to be and took off the mufflers where it Y'ed out. Sounds soooo good, people are amazed at the sound of it and how it is very deep for a 4 cyl. Power increases are great as well, not as good as a cat-back, but for a $30 dollar glass pack compared to a $400-$500 dollar cat, the sound is awesome. I promise you will love the sound, it sounds like the eclipse on The F&F but a tad bit deeper. Been driving around with them off for about 6 months now and cops haven't said anything to me, as long as you keep your cataylic on, your fine. Definately recommend trying it before you go in on $500.
